New hooks, designs and styles. Identification of parts and descriptions

New fish hooks.

Circle hook is identified as a hook with a generally circular shape and a point whichs turns inward, pointing directly back at the shank at a 90 degees or more with no off set to the point. The size is determined by gap size. See chart below.

J hook is identified as a hook with a generally circular shape and a point which turns generally parallel to the hook shank. The size is determined by gap size. See chart below.

Sizes of all salt water hooks are based on gap sizes.

1//0 = gap .100 to .199
2/0 = gap .200 to .299
3/0 = gap .300 to .399
4/0 = gap .400 to .499
5/0 = gap .500 to .599
6/0 = gap .600 to .699
7/0 = gap .700 to .799
8/0 = gap .800 to .899
9/0 = gap .900 to .999
10/0 = gap 1.00 to 1.99

etc.
